Coverup And Denial In Japan

By Stephen Lendman

15 March, 2011
Countercurrents.org

Discount all official government statements and major media reports repeating them instead of demanding expert, unbiased views.

Officially, Japan's nuclear emergency is under control and contained. In fact, lies substitute for truths, denial for reality, and managed news for honest reporting.

Point of fact: Besides its catastrophic quake, tsunami, destructive aftershocks, and resulting humanitarian crisis, Japan is experiencing a developing nuclear catastrophe, the full extent not known until independent sources reveal it.

On March 12, a huge explosion rocked Fukushima's Unit 1 reactor. Reports said its containment chamber was intact. Independent experts are skeptical, believing at least some damage occurred, perhaps a major breach now covered up. Japan's Nuclear and Industrial Safety Agency (NISA) blamed a core meltdown for the explosion, releasing hazardous atmospheric radioactive cesium-137 and iodine-131.

Second Nuclear Explosion Rocks Japan

On March 14, Reuters headlined, "Japan grapples with nuclear crisis," saying:

A second explosion blew off a containment facility's roof. A third reactor's cooling system failed. Officials claimed no reactor's been harmed. As explained above, independent experts are skeptical, believing powerful explosions damage or destroy everything nearby, what official reports won't reveal.

As a result, "Japan scrambled to avert (multiple) meltdown(s) at a stricken nuclear reactor on Monday."

Live NHK video showed the reactor facility's skeletal remains, thick smoke rising and spreading. Multiple injuries were reported. Workers inside were exposed to extremely high radiation levels endangering their lives.

Thousands of quake/tsunami-related deaths are confirmed. Tens of thousands are missing and unaccounted for. In Otsuchi, ICRC's Patrick Fuller described "a scene from hell, absolutely nightmarish." As many as 10,000 people, half the town's population, may have perished, besides many others in Northern Japan.

On March 13, New York Times writers David Sanger and Matthew Wald headlined, "Radioactive Releases in Japan Could Last Months, Experts Say," stating:

Flooding two stricken reactors with corrosive seawater (rendering them henceforth inoperable) is "a desperate step to avoid a much bigger problem: a full meltdown," perhaps ongoing but concealed. Japanese officials and media reports call it "partial." Radioactive steam is being released to relieve pressure, spreading atmospheric poison.

A widening area is being contaminated. Tens of thousands evacuated "may not be able to return to their homes for a considerable period," perhaps never, depending on contamination levels. "More steam releases also mean (spreading contamination) across the Pacific...." Discount America's Nuclear Regulatory Commission saying:

"Hawaii, Alaska, the US Territories, and the US West Coast are not expected to experience any harmful levels of radioactivity."

False! Atmospheric winds and rain potentially may contaminate planet earth, some areas more than others. A worried unnamed official said, "under the best scenarios, this isn't going to end anytime soon," or perhaps well.

Another concern affects some Japanese reactors plus others in France and Germany. They use mox (mixed oxide) fuel, containing reclaimed plutonium - the most hazardous known substance. When ingested, a tiny spec can kill. Larger inhaled atmospheric amounts could devastate whole cities. Two damaged Fukushima units use it, Nos. 2 and 3.

Sanger and Wald added:

"Inside the plant....there was deep concern that spent nuclear fuel that was kept in a 'cooling pond' (began) letting off potentially deadly gamma radiation. Then water levels inside the reactor cores began to fall. (An estimated) top four to nine feet of nuclear fuel in the core and control rods appear to have been exposed to the air - a condition that" caused melting, potentially a "full meltdown" that may, in fact, be happening.

Using corrosive seawater may, in fact, not work. Because of high containment vessel pressure, forcing it inside is like "trying to pour water into an inflated balloon," according to one unnamed source. It's not clear how much water is getting in and whether cores are covered. Damaged gauges make knowing it impossible, so doing it is seat-of-the-pants, a "Hail Mary" attempt at best.

Operating 55 nuclear facilities, Japan relies heavily on them for electricity, at present 30%, a figure expected to reach 50% by 2030 if planned additions are completed.

Tokyo Electric Power's (TEPCO) Shoddy Maintenance and Safety Record

On March 12, Los Angeles Times writers Mark Magnier and Barbara Demick headlined, "Japanese fearful as nuclear crisis builds," saying:

"(M)any Japanese don't trust (what) authorities (tell) them" anymore. Moreover, they "have an uncomfortable relationship with nuclear power" and TEPCO, Fukushima's operator.

"As many people (know, it) has a history of not being forthcoming about nuclear safety issues, particularly those surrounding earthquake-related dangers."

In 2003, its 17 nuclear plants were temporarily shut for falsifying safety inspection reports. In 2006, it was learned that its coolant-water data at two plants were falsified in the 1980s. Critics have long expressed deep concern about safety at many of Japan's nuclear facilities," some dating from the 1970s and 1980s.

Fukushima especially "has long been on critics' radar, but so has the Hamaoka plant," 100 miles southwest of Toyko on an active fault line. In fact, Kobe University Professor Emeritus Katsuhiko Ishibashi said:

"I have been warning about Japan's possibility of a genpatsu shinsai - a nuclear disaster," explaining that many nuclear facilities are hazardously located in seismically unsafe locations. No one listened.

On March 13, Kyodo News said another cooling system failed at Tokai's No. 2 facility, 120 km from Tokyo. Emergency measures were taken. Unreliable reports say a backup pump and cooling system are operating. Fukushima's No. 1 and 3 reactors experienced meltdowns. Kyodo called its No. 2 "troubled," raising fears of the worst there, besides what's happening at Tokai No. 2 and perhaps other quake/tsunami affected reactors.

Nuclear plants use radioactive material for heat to generate electricity. Huge amounts are needed. To prevent overheating, "vast amounts of coolant are required, up to a million gallons of water a minute." Without it, meltdowns occur, because "in less than a minute," temperatures can reach 5,000 degrees Fahrenheit - hot enough to "burn through the cement bottom of the nuclear plant" to earth beneath.

Nuclear scientists call it the "China syndrome," meaning "it descends to the water table underlying a plant. Then, in a violent reaction, molten core and cold water combine, creating steam explosions and releasing a plume of radioactive poisons."

Where it spreads depends on wind velocity, direction, and rain. Nuclear reactors are vulnerable, life-threatening, and "the most dangerous way to boil water ever devised."
